Rocky Mountain Bighorn Sheep, Banff National Park

 

Bighorn sheep are commonly spotted in the Rocky Mountains.  Usually, you'll see small bachelor groups, or larger collections of ewes and lambs.

IMG_8150

This group was spotted in early May near the Banff townsite.  It's a little unusual in that it's a large group of comingled males and females.  They were grazing on early spring grass and were so close to us we could actually hear them chewing.
